You will discover 3 forms of zar in Ethiopia, although this difference just isn't always named by Ethiopians by themselves, only viewing the version they know as zār and never automatically being aware of in the Many others. "Conversion" zār is the most common, involving Females and trance. It is actually termed as such following the "conversion hysterical response", not soon after religious conversion. Ceremonies often come about along side holiday seasons.

, An examination from the background and waning lifestyle of zar in Egypt, and the entire world during which Muslim Females negotiate relations with spirits Zar is both equally a possessing spirit in addition to a list of reconciliation rites concerning the spirits and their human hosts: living in a parallel yet invisible earth, the capricious spirits manifest their anger by causing ailments for their hosts, which demand ritual reconciliation, A non-public sacrificial rite practiced routinely via the stricken devotees. Originally spread from Ethiopia to your Purple Sea along with the Arabian Gulf with the nineteenth-century slave trade, in Egypt zar has included aspects from well-liked Islamic Sufi tactics, including devotion to Christian and Muslim saints. The ceremonies initiate devotees--nearly all of whom are Muslim Girls--right into a Neighborhood centered with a cult leader, a membership that provides them with ethical orientation, social assist, and a sense of belonging. Training zar rituals, dancing to zar music, and encountering trance restore their perfectly-currently being, which had been compromised by gender asymmetry and globalization. This new ethnographic study of zar in Egypt is based around the writer's two yrs of multi-sited fieldwork and firsthand awareness as a participant, and her selection and Examination of much more than three hundred zar tracks, allowing for her to entry amounts of which means that experienced Beforehand been disregarded. The end result is a comprehensive and available exposition in the heritage, culture, and waning apply of zar in a very modernizing planet.

Among the Somalis, saar continues to be in decrease, but has also remodeled into staying expressed at sitaat rituals and wedding parties, or at the least All those Areas absorbing and serving an analogous function for Gals who at the time would've done saar. It had been banned beneath the British Protectorate in 1955, and mingis specially was banned by the Union of Islamic Courts, which took electrical power in 2006. Public view of All those not in the team is adverse as Adult men and women blend, non-halal substances might be consumed (Alcoholic beverages and blood), and the spirits really should be prevented but are as an alternative named forth.

Friday is definitely the working day with the ritual procession and sacrifice for al-Jilani, which take place in the open up. Individuals take in initial, as well as ceremony begins around 5pm. Ideally Anyone wears white, that's al-Jilani's color. The zaffa (procession) is very first, While using the shaykha and jalīsa escorting the initiate out on the tumbura home to sit down before the sanjak because the tahlīl is performed. The shaykha and brigdar existing the al-Jilani and Bilal flags on the sanjak, along with the procession starts. It is just a counterclockwise half walk-50 percent dance within the maydān although the sanjak performs zaffa music.

Cure includes negotiating With all the spirit and is considered prosperous In the event the patient feels relief following trance. As soon as the title is exposed, the health care provider asks what would remember to the spirit, and it will title some things and an animal. These will be procured (These are called the like present into the zar, maqwadasha) along with the animal is sacrificed. The patient eats a lot of the meat.

The expression zār may very well be used to imply several various things within the destinations the belief is identified: it might confer with the hierarchy of zār spirits, an individual spirit of this sort, the ceremonies concerning these spirits, the possessed man or woman, or even the troubles a result of these spirits.[ten]

Bori and tumbura experienced ties towards the North and Egypt and also Sudan, but nugāra was decidedly southern. Nugāra associated music nerd southern garments, hefty drums, A lot drama, and fireplace. It absolutely was viewed as getting intently tied to sorcery and "harmful, non-Islamic" magic. These different rites were not mutually unique in Sennar, and each was regarded valuable for various reasons, and unique users of the same family members at times belonged to distinct types of zār. There's a distinct Sennar tumbura custom, which regards Zainab, a domestically famed bori practitioner, with respect.[26]
